The magic of a snow day often conjures feelings of childhood nostalgia – the excitement of waking up to a blanket of white, the hope of school cancellations, and the simple joy of sledding with family. When the forecast hints at falling flakes, it’s the perfect cue to craft a plan for embracing the winter wonderland.

A truly ideal snow day often begins with a comforting warm beverage, a delicious pancake breakfast, and a refreshing walk outdoors. For those with children, this outdoor excursion can easily transform into a lively snowball fight, the construction of a whimsical snowman, or exhilarating sledding adventures. Following the outdoor fun, the focus shifts to indoor coziness. Many find solace in immersing themselves in a winter-themed book or film, perhaps while indulging in some delightful baking. The day often culminates with a hearty, comforting dinner, with soup being a popular choice, though any soul-warming recipe will suffice. A relaxing evening spent watching more television, perhaps with the gentle flicker of a candle, provides the perfect finishing touch to a memorable snow day.

Whether you’re a solo snow enthusiast, enjoying the day with a partner, or creating memories with your family, there are countless ways to make the most of a snowy day. From actively engaging with the winter elements to seeking cozy indoor distractions, these activities offer something for everyone, proving that winter truly has its own unique charm.

Embracing the Winter Chill: Snow Day Activities for Everyone

Here’s a curated list of activities to transform any snow day into a cherished experience:

  • Craft a Steaming Mug of Hot Cocoa: Nothing quite beats the warmth of hot cocoa on a cold day. Elevate this classic treat by setting up a “hot cocoa bar.” Offer a variety of toppings such as mini marshmallows, crushed candy canes, chocolate shavings, and your favorite candies. This can be a delightful alternative to your usual morning coffee.

  • Organize a Video Game Tournament: Video games offer entertainment for all ages and skill levels. Whether you delve into an immersive role-playing game, engage in some friendly fighting game action, or compete in a virtual race, a little bit of competition can bring warmth and excitement indoors, regardless of the weather outside.

  • Bake a Batch of Delicious Cookies: The aroma of freshly baked cookies can fill your home with a comforting scent, far surpassing any candle. Baking is also an excellent way to keep younger hands occupied during a long snow day. Plus, the reward is indulging in your delicious creations. Consider baking an extra batch to freeze for future cravings of homemade goodness.

  • Construct a Snowman Masterpiece: Take inspiration from beloved winter tales and ask, “Do you wanna build a snowman?” To add an extra layer of fun, turn it into a friendly competition to see who can create the most imaginative and unique snow figure.

  • Simmer a Pot of Comforting Soup: Boiling up a pot of soup is not only a wonderful cold-weather activity but also a fantastic method for using up ingredients from your refrigerator or pantry. Don’t forget to have some crusty bread on hand for dipping into the flavorful broth.

  • Experience the Thrill of Sledding: Sledding offers a dual winter delight. The exhilarating rush of sliding down a snowy hill is both exciting and a little bit thrilling. The trek back up the hill for another run provides a great cardiovascular workout. Remember to pause for some warm cocoa to thaw out afterward.

  • Dream Up Your Next Vacation: While snow falls outside, use the time to plan for warmer days ahead by booking a summer vacation. Even if it’s just a day of imaginative planning, browsing beach houses, tropical destinations, or far-off shores can transport your mind to a sunnier state.

  • Build an Epic Indoor Fort: All it takes are some sheets and blankets to construct the ultimate cozy hideaway. Reconnect with your inner child and discover the simple comfort and joy of having a secret sanctuary, especially when shared with little ones.

  • Ignite a Cozy Fire: If you have a fireplace, get it roaring and savor the unique, comforting scent of a real fire. Under suitable conditions, you might even be able to build a safe outdoor fire on a crisp winter evening.

  • Engage in a Spirited Snowball Fight: Make the most of the abundant snow by bundling up and heading outside for an energetic snowball fight. It’s a surprisingly good form of exercise and is guaranteed to end in peals of laughter.

  • Begin a Cherished Scrapbook: You don’t need to be an expert crafter to beautifully display your treasured memories. In our digital age, simply printing out your favorite photographs and assembling them into an album can feel incredibly special and personal.

  • Lose Yourself in a Good Book: Brew a cup of tea, grab a plush blanket, and snuggle up with an engaging book. Escaping into another world becomes even more delightful when a snowstorm is raging outside.

  • Infuse Your Home with Aroma: Aromatherapy can significantly boost your mood and make your home smell wonderfully inviting. Many attractive candles are available at accessible price points, offering an affordable way to enhance comfort. Lighting a candle can make your living space feel exceptionally cozy.

  • Embark on a Movie Marathon Adventure: Some days are simply meant for television. Turn it into an event by preparing a large bowl of popcorn, gathering an assortment of snacks, donning your coziest pajamas (even during the day!), and fully embracing a movie marathon. You could pick a theme, watch an actor’s entire filmography, or let each family member choose the next feature.

  • Indulge in a Relaxing Bubble Bath: Feel the tension melt away as you sink into a warm, soothing bubble bath. Enhance the experience by lighting some candles, brewing a calming cup of tea, and playing some relaxing music.

  • Gather for a Classic Board Game: Turn off your electronic devices and come together around a game board for some timeless fun that requires no electricity. Teach the children a beloved classic or explore a new game for a mentally stimulating activity that doesn’t feel like work.

  • Piece Together a Captivating Puzzle: Engaging with puzzles can contribute to brain health and help the hours fly by. Sit down with the entire household to tackle a puzzle together, or set one up on the coffee table to be worked on over several days or even weeks.
